### Static-analysis baseline (Murkwell scanner)

Heads up: the Murkwell baseline file (`murkwell-baseline.json`) suppresses pre-existing findings so new code gets a clean signal. Never add fresh findings to the baseline to quiet a failing build — that defeats the point. Shrinking the file is always fine; growing it needs sign-off from the Harrowgate security rotation. Regenerate it only after a tracked remediation sprint, and note the diff in the PR description. The regeneration steps and sign-off checklist live on this internal page.

wiki page, fahaf-yagag: https://confluence.qorvellabs.internal/pages/display/pages/display

## Ticket: Config drift in Validex plugin sandbox

Validex validator plugins are supposed to run under identical sandbox settings in all regions. Audit shows the east cluster diverged after a hotfix in March: plugin network egress was re-enabled and the memory cap raised, never reverted. This widens the attack surface for third-party validators and bypasses the review assumptions from last quarter. Requesting security sign-off before we force-sync. For reference, the intended baseline configuration is as follows.

settings of fafog-haduf:
ZORIX_PIN=4648
ZORIX_METRICS_HOST=metrics.zorix.paliqsys.corp
ZORIX_LOG_LEVEL=info
ZORIX_TENANT=druix

Handing over the image-slimming work on the Pellagrin stack — sharing this with you since it touches the security posture. Short version: we moved everything to distroless-style bases, dropped the shell and package manager from prod images, and the attack surface shrank a lot (scan reports in the shared folder). Two services still carry a debug sidecar; that's tracked and should land next sprint. The SBOM generation step is wired into CI now, so nothing ships unscanned. Ongoing ownership sits with the person named below.

signatory, fafog-bagef: Jorwyn Juleth Pelius